Because the downloaded file has extracted, we can use the folder that is in the temp folder to perform a level 3 uninstall. A level-three uninstall is more comprehensive than the add-remove programs uninstall. Please use the following instructions to resolve the issue. 

  1. Hold down the Windows Logo key (  ) on the keyboard and the 'R' to open the run box,  type %temp%
  2. Look for, and open the folder starting with 7z (Example: 7zS2356)
  3. Open folder Util
  4. Open folder CCC
  5. If you have an HP computer run the L3uninstall.exe. If you have a non-HP computer run the L4uninstall.exe
  6. When the uninstall has completed restart the computer
  7. Follow these steps to reset the registry settings and options for Windows Installer.
    • Click Start, and then click Run.
    • In the Open box, type msiexec /unreg, and then click OK.
    • Click Start, and then click Run.
    • In the  Open box, type msiexec /regserver, and then click OK
  8. Run Disk cleanup from Accessories\ System Tools
  9. Download and install the latest version of Adobe flash player http://www.adobe.com/support/flashplayer/downloads​.html
  10. Now we can restart the computer
